Full text
Be it enacted by the Council as follows:
Section 1. Article 1 of subchapter 1 of chapter 2 of title 27 of the administrative code of the city of New York is amended by adding a new section 27-2005.1 to read as follows:
§27-2005.1 Placement of persons by city agencies in buildings with tenant harassment prohibited. No person receiving public funds or subsidies shall be placed or referred for residence in a dwelling by any city agency where a court of competent jurisdiction has found a violation of subdivision d of section 27-2005 of this chapter three or more times within the immediately preceding five years.
§2. This local law shall take effect immediately upon enactment.
